SPECTRE Vol. 3 #7 Cover Credit: Dan Brereton (artist; signed) |
Story: "Vision and Power" (24 Pages)
| Credits: John Ostrander (plot, script); Tom Mandrake (pencils, inks); Todd Klein (letters); Digital Chameleon (colors); Dan Raspler (edits) |
Feature Character: The Spectre (also in flashback in between Last Days of the Justice Society Special #1 and Spectre Vol. 2 #1
Supporting Characters: Amy Beitermann; Jim Corrigan (in flashback preceding flashback in Spectre Vol. 2 #6; see Comment for Spectre Vol. 2 #1)
Villains: Madame Xanadu (also in flashback in between Crisis on Infinite Earths #12 and flashback in Spectre Vol. 2 #5), Kim Liang, Cynner, Hassan Al-Armani, Bug McGrew, Betty Bumphus (all five revealed as sendings of Madame Xanadu, portions of her soul made palable); Duke (first appearance; a pimp; dies); Danny Geller
Other Character: Roger Jamiston (first appearance; C.E.O. of Green Industries)
Synopsis:
The shade of Jim Corrigan has been torn from the Spectre and the powerful disembodied spirit now inhabits the form of Madame Xanadu. As Corrigan's ghost fades from this world, he must deside whether he cares enough about humanity to resume the terrible mantle of the Spectre, or to let the now mad Madame Xanadu destroy everything that displeases her.|
